Havoc squeeze by Bobcats

Dec 31, 2022

                  2-1 Final Score

After a long layoff due to the two postponed games last week, the Vermilion County Bobcats finally took the ice for a game as they traveled to Huntsville to take on the Havoc. The Bobcats welcomed back Brendan Murphy and Sullivan Shortreed back into the lineup for the first time in a couple of weeks.


In the first period, VC was not able to capitalize on the only penalty called against Huntsville. The Havoc did score almost thirteen minutes in to take a 1-0 lead into the 1st intermission.


Huntsville took a 2-0 lead around the ten minute mark in the second. Vermilion County was given a great opportunity to tie the game as Huntsville took two penalties to give the Bobcats a 5-3 man opportunity for 52 seconds. They were not able to score, and Huntsville went into the third period with not only a 2-0 lead, but a power play to start the third.


The Bobcats killed off Huntsville's only power play and dominated the play in the third. As it looked like they were going to be shutout, the Bobcats pulled the goalie in the last three minutes. A scrum in front of the Huntsville net allowed Justin Portillo to put home a rebound to break up the shutout and cut the lead to 2-1 with 10 seconds left in the game. VC was not able to get the equalizer  in the end, giving the Havoc a 2-1 victory in front of a sold out crowd.


Brett Epp made 29 of 31 saves, as his record falls to 1-10-0. The Bobcats were 0-4 on the power play, their 4th straight game without a power play goal.  The team is now 3-17-1-0 for the season.
